You will study this program full-time on campus over two years, integrating theoretical knowledge with extensive practical experience. The curriculum includes hands-on learning in areas such as child development, curriculum philosophies, and health and safety, alongside practical application through three substantial field placements. These placements, totalling 630 hours, allow you to apply classroom learning in real-world early learning environments.
